Do Hybrid Cars Need to Be Charged? A Clear Guide for HEV and PHEV Owners

Whether a hybrid car needs to be charged depends entirely on which type of hybrid you're driving. Standard hybrids (HEVs) and mild hybrids (MHEVs) never need to be plugged in — they generate all the electricity they need while you drive. Plug-in hybrids (PHEVs), on the other hand, don't require charging to run, but they're built around the idea that you will: skip it regularly and you lose the entire point of owning one.


This guide breaks down exactly how each hybrid type charges, what actually happens if a PHEV owner never plugs in, and how to set up a practical charging routine at home, in an apartment, or on the road.


Hybrid Isn't One Thing — MHEV, HEV, and PHEV Explained


"Hybrid" gets used as a catch-all term, but the three main types behave very differently when it comes to charging.


Mild Hybrid (MHEV)


A mild hybrid pairs a small electric motor with a gas engine mainly to smooth out start-stop driving and take some load off the engine at low speeds. The battery is small, there's no meaningful electric-only driving, and there's no plug at all. It charges purely through the engine and light regenerative braking.

Full Hybrid (HEV)


A full — or "standard" — hybrid can briefly run on electric power alone, usually for less than a mile at low speed, before the gas engine takes back over. Its battery recharges continuously as you drive, through regenerative braking and short bursts of engine-driven charging. There's no charge port, and there's nothing to plug in, ever.


Plug-In Hybrid (PHEV)


A PHEV carries a much larger battery than an HEV, along with an actual charging port. That bigger battery is designed to be topped up from the grid so the car can drive on electricity alone for a meaningful distance — usually somewhere between 20 and 50 miles — before quietly switching over to the gas engine. This is the only hybrid category where the "do I need to charge it?" question has a real, practical answer.

How a Hybrid Battery Actually Recharges


Every hybrid, plug-in or not, relies on some combination of three charging methods.

Regenerative braking captures the kinetic energy that would otherwise be lost as heat when you slow down, converting it back into stored electricity. It's constant, automatic, and works the same way whether you're driving an HEV or a PHEV.


Engine-driven charging uses the gas engine itself to spin an internal generator under certain conditions, feeding the battery even while you're accelerating or cruising. This is the main reason standard hybrids never need a plug.


External (plug-in) charging is unique to PHEVs. Connecting the car to a wall outlet or a dedicated charging station sends electricity from the grid directly into the battery — no gas involved, no driving required.


So, Do Hybrid Cars Need to Be Charged? The Direct Answer


No, if it's a standard or mild hybrid. These vehicles are engineered to manage their own battery entirely through driving. There's no plug, no charging port, and no scenario where you'd need one.Not strictly, if it's a plug-in hybrid — but you're leaving value on the table if you skip it. A PHEV will start and drive perfectly well with a completely empty high-voltage battery; it simply behaves like a heavier, slightly less efficient standard hybrid. The manufacturer's intent, though, is for you to plug in regularly and use the electric-only range for the bulk of your daily driving.


What Happens If You Never Plug In a PHEV?


Nothing dramatic — the car won't leave you stranded, and there's no mechanical risk in occasional or even long-term non-charging. But there are real trade-offs:


  • You pay for a battery you're not using. PHEVs cost more upfront specifically for that larger battery pack. Never charging it means paying the premium without the payoff.
  • Fuel economy takes a hit. Hauling a large, uncharged battery adds weight without adding benefit, so an uncharged PHEV typically returns somewhat worse fuel economy than an equivalent standard hybrid.
  • You miss the cheapest miles you'll ever drive. Electricity from a home outlet is almost always less expensive per mile than gasoline, especially for short daily trips.
  • Battery health can be affected over time. Manufacturers generally recommend cycling the battery rather than leaving it sitting at a very low charge for extended periods — check your owner's manual for specific guidance.


If your daily commute is short and your driveway has an outlet, not charging a PHEV is essentially choosing to pay more for the same trip.

Real Charging Scenarios PHEV Owners Actually Deal With


Charging habits look different depending on where and how you live — here's how it plays out in practice.


Home charging overnight. Most PHEV owners simply plug in when they get home and unplug in the morning to a full battery. A standard household outlet is usually enough, since the smaller PHEV battery doesn't need the faster charge rate an EV would.


Apartment or condo living without a dedicated charger. Without off-street parking or an installed home charger, a compact portable EV charger that plugs into any standard outlet becomes the practical option — it travels with the car and doesn't require any home installation or landlord approval.


Daily commuting. For most PHEV drivers, a full overnight charge easily covers a round-trip commute entirely on electricity, with the gas engine kept in reserve for longer errands.


Road trips. This is where PHEVs shine over full EVs — when the battery runs down, the car simply switches to gasoline, so there's no need to plan routes around charging stops.


Public charging. PHEVs generally connect at Level 2 public stations using a J1772 plug in North America, or a Type 2 connector across the UK, Europe, and Australia. How to Charge a Plug-In Hybrid at Home


Level 1 Charging (Standard Outlet)


Level 1 charging uses a regular household outlet (120V in North America, 230–240V in the UK, Europe, and Australia) and typically takes 8–12 hours for a full charge from empty. For most PHEVs — which have smaller batteries than full EVs — this comfortably fits an overnight charging window. Level 2 Charging (240V Station)


A Level 2 setup uses a dedicated 240V circuit and cuts charging time down to roughly 2–3 hours. It's a worthwhile upgrade for households with more than one plug-in vehicle, or for drivers who want the battery topped up quickly between short trips rather than relying on an overnight window.

What Charging a PHEV Actually Costs


Charging cost depends on local electricity rates, but the comparison to gasoline is consistently favorable for short trips. As a rough example: fully charging a typical PHEV battery at home generally costs a few dollars, depending on your local electricity rate and battery size — usually a fraction of what the same distance would cost in gasoline. Because PHEV batteries are smaller than full EV batteries, a complete charge is also quick and inexpensive relative to the miles it delivers.


The exact savings depend on your electricity rate, local fuel prices, and how much of your driving happens on battery versus gas — but for anyone doing mostly short trips, plugging in consistently is almost always the cheaper habit.


Keeping Your Hybrid Battery Healthy


A few habits go a long way toward protecting a PHEV's battery over the life of the vehicle:

  • Avoid leaving the battery at 0% for extended periods. Occasional full depletion is fine, but chronic long-term storage at empty isn't ideal for lithium-ion cells.
  • Charge regularly rather than sporadically. Frequent, moderate charging is generally easier on the battery than infrequent, deep cycles.
  • Precondition the cabin while still plugged in during cold weather. This uses grid electricity to warm the car instead of draining the battery once you're driving.
  • Follow your manufacturer's specific guidance. Battery chemistry and management systems vary between models, and your owner's manual will have the most accurate recommendations for your specific vehicle.
